BUJUMBURA, JUNE 30 2015 – The Parliamentary Elections in Burundi went on, Monday June 29 despite international calls to postpone the controversial elections.
The Electoral commission though expecting 3.8 million people to vote reported delays and low voter turnout, as many people feared eruption of violence.
Sporadic gunshots and blasts were reportedSunday night but elections went on amid heavy security presence especially in the capital, but polling stations closed early due to low voter turnout and fear of unrest.
The Catholic Church had in the month of May decided to abstain from the election saying that it was full of gaps.
The African Union and the European Union abstained from being observers at the election saying that conditions for a free and fair election were not met.
